episode Acute Trauma: How Your Brain Helps You Survive the Unthinkable artwork

Acute Trauma: How Your Brain Helps You Survive the Unthinkable

In this episode of Her Brain Matters, we explore what happens in the brain during and after acute trauma. Drawing on neuroscience and psychology, we break down how the brain’s survival systems take over, why memory and time can feel distorted, and why responses such as freeze, dissociation, and hypervigilance are not signs of weakness, but of adaptation. With a smaller focus on women’s neurobiology, this episode offers language, understanding, and compassion for how acute trauma shapes the brain and how healing begins. episode Meditation in Your Mind artwork

Meditation in Your Mind

Mindfulness and meditation have become mainstream buzzwords, but what do these practices actually do for our brains and bodies? In this episode, we’ll explore the neuroscience behind meditation, how it impacts stress, memory, and attention, and why consistency matters more than time. You will hear from two experts from the Mindfulness Center at the Brown University School of Public Health, Dr. Jeffrey Proulx and Professor Lynn Koerbel. Guided by their incredible insight and research, we unpack the cultural roots, modern adaptations, and accessible forms of mindfulness that can fit into any lifestyle.
